is a small coastal town in , 25 km south of , in . According to the 2008 census It has a population of 37,686. It was founded by French settlers under the name Mondovi in 1848 and remained as Mondovi until 1962, when Algeria declared its independence and most of the French residents of the town chose to leave. is situated 4½ km northwest of Chihani.

is a city in . It was founded by the French in the early 19th century 1868 as a colonial district "Commune". It was given the name of Randon after the French Army general Jacques Louis Randon, but the local population used to call the area "Besbes" which was given to the city as a formal name after Algeria's independence in 1962. is situated 8 km northeast of Chihani.
